Polymastia pacifica (Lambe, 1893)
Aggregated nipple sponge
No Picture Available

Family:  Polymastiidae ()
Max. size:  2 cm H (male/unsexed)
Environment:  sessile; marine; depth range 0 - 15 m
Distribution:  Eastern Pacific: USA, Canada and Alaska.
Diagnosis:   
Biology:  White to yellow pale, breast-shaped individuals (1.2 cm at base and 2.0 cm in height) with single osculum; aggregations may cover 60-90 cm across. On rocks with sandy pockets at the very low intertidal zone (Ref. 865).
